Front Center Seat: Installation

2021 Ford Edge SE, 4WDSECTION Installation
WARNING: This page is about a different car, the 2020 Ford F-150. However, it is still accessible from the selected car via links, so may be relevant.
  1. To install, reverse the removal procedure.
  2. Install the center seat bolts in the following sequence.

    1. Install the RH center bolt.

      Torque: 41 lb.ft (55 Nm)

    2. Install the RH rear bolt..

      Torque: 41 lb.ft (55 Nm)

    3. Install the RH front bolt.

      Torque: 41 lb.ft (55 Nm)

    4. Install the LH rear bolt.

      Torque: 41 lb.ft (55 Nm)

    5. Install the LH front bolt.

      Torque: 41 lb.ft (55 Nm)
